private void OnCallback(GAFBaseClip obj) { var audioSource = GetComponent <AudioSource>(); if (audioSource != null) { audioSource.Play(); } }
//public override List<GAFTransform> timelines //{ // get // { // return m_Timelines; // } //} #endregion // Properties #region Interface /// <summary> /// Initialize object manager parameters. /// <para />Animation subobjects are created here. /// </summary> public override void initialize() { //cachedRenderer.hideFlags = HideFlags.NotEditable; //cachedFilter.hideFlags = HideFlags.NotEditable; m_MovieClip = GetComponent <GAFBaseClip>(); m_SortingManager = GetComponent <GAFSortingManager>(); m_SortingManager.initialize(); createObjects(); }